Getting to Know… BraveHeart First Aid Incorporated

We’re BraveHeart First Aid — a community-based training team based right here in the Valley.

You may have heard of us before, but there’s something new happening behind the scenes. BraveHeart has new owners — Stefanie and Eli Castson, a Valley-based family with two kids and a love for this quieter, close-knit part of Nova Scotia.

As a Swiss Canadian Family, they were drawn to the open spaces, Fundy shore sunsets, and what they call the “Canada of yesteryear” feeling that’s hard to describe but easy to love.

Not long after moving here, Eli went looking to renew his first aid certification. Living rural, where help isn’t always close, it just felt like the right thing to do. That’s how they found BraveHeart — and something about it clicked. When the opportunity came to
Buy BraveHeart, their hearts knew it was meant to be.

Founded by Nancy O’Halloran, BraveHeart started with a single course and grew into Nova Scotia’s largest independent first aid training company — certifying over 5000 each year and known for its warm, engaging approach to lifesaving education. We’re proud to continue that legacy.

Stefanie brings a background in Physiotherapy and now leads as our Director of Training. Eli also owns a Digital Company and this will support behind the scenes with systems, planning, and logistics.

The rest of the BraveHeart crew has stayed on board — the same kind friendly faces who’ve been teaching, guiding, and supporting learners across the province.

And while the ownership has changed, the mission hasn’t. If anything, it’s stronger than ever. We still focus on making first aid feel simple, doable, and brave. You won’t find pressure or panic in our classrooms — just solid support and down-to-earth teaching.

We offer Emergency First Aid, Standard First Aid, CPR, Marine First Aid, and youth programs like Babysitter and Stay Safe. We run regular sessions at our headquarters in Kentville Business Park and book private courses across Nova Scotia.

There are plans to expand with new offerings in the future, but our heart remains the same: helping people feel ready to step up and help, no matter where they are. That’s where our name comes from. First aid doesn’t make you fearless. It just gives you enough knowledge to be brave.

FIRE UPDATE

There are multiple fires across the province - this post will be updated throughout the day.

SUSIES LAKE WILDFIRE, HALIFAX COUNTY, 15 AUGUST, 7:30 PM

Susies Lake wildfire (estimated at 15 hectares) is now under control. 20 Department of Natural Resources (DNR) and 15 Halifax Fire and Emergency firefighters are working to extinguish. This is our last update on Susies Lake.

LONG LAKE WILDFIRE COMPLEX, ANNAPOLIS COUNTY, AUGUST 15, 7:30 PM

The Long Lake wildfire in West Dalhousie is still out of control. The size is still estimated to be about 406 hectares. Air resources dropping water this evening include 1 Department of Natural Resources (DNR) helicopter and 2 contracted helicopters. Ground crews include 44 DNR and 60 local firefighters. Fire break work continues.

Hoyt Lake (estimated 1 hectare) continues to be held. Ground crew includes 3 DNR firefighters.

Next update on the Long Lake wildfire complex will be tomorrow morning.

---

LONG LAKE WILDFIRE COMPLEX, ANNAPOLIS COUNTY, AUGUST 15, 4:00PM

The Long Lake fire in West Dalhousie is still out of control. The size is still estimated to be about 406 hectares. Air resources dropping water this afternoon include 2 DNR helicopters, 2 contracted helicopters and 2 CL415 planes from Quebec. Ground crews include 44 DNR and 60 local firefighters. Fire break work continues.

Hoyt Lake (estimated 1 hectare) is still being held. 3 DNR firefighters on Hoyt. Next update on Long Lake complex this evening.

Durland Lake Brook (estimated 0.5 hectares) is now under control. 5 DNR and 23 local firefighters working to extinguish. This is our last update on Durland.

SUSIES LAKE WILDFIRE, HALIFAX COUNTY, 15 AUGUST, 4:00 PM
There has been no change in status of Susies Lake wildfire since our morning update. It is still being held, still estimated at 15 hectares and progress is being made to get it under control. 30 DN and 6 Halifax Fire and Emergency firefighters still on the scene. Next update this evening.

---

12:35 pm:

Long Lake Wildfire Complex

There has been no change in the Long Lake wildfire complex since our morning update. Please note that we have shifted to this name for the fires that we initially referred to as West Dalhousie. Updates will continue through the day.

A wildfire complex is several fires (in this case, Long Lake, Hoyt Lake and Durland Lake Brook) that are being managed by one incident management team with resources being moved between them as necessary.

9:50am:

West Dalhousie:
The Long Lake fire in West Dalhousie still out of control. The size is still estimated at 406 hectares. Same air resources as yesterday. 33 Department of Natural Resources (DNR) firefighters and ten local firefighters are on the scene. Heavy equipment is continuing fire barrier work.
Hoyt Lake (estimated 1 hectare) and Durland Lake Brook (estimated 0.5 hectares) fires are now being held. They are part of the Long Lake complex. Two DNR firefighters are on Hoyt, five DNR and 12 local firefighters on Durland. Updates through the day.

Susies Lake:
Susies Lake wildfire is still being held – not currently growing. 30 Department of Natural Resources firefighters and six Halifax Fire and Emergency firefighters on scene this morning, working to get it under control. Updates through the day.

🚨 Wildfire Evacuation Preparedness – Nova Scotia 🚨
KEEP PHONE CHARGED
GAS FULL


Wildfires can move fast — minutes matter.
Here’s how to be ready BEFORE you’re told to leave:

1. Know Your Routes♥️
Plan at least 2–3 exits from your neighbourhood.
Avoid routes that pass through heavy wooded areas if possible.

2. Pack a “Go Bag”♥️

Government-issued ID & important documents
Prescription medications & glasses/contacts
Phone & charger (portable power bank if possible)
Water & non-perishable snacks
Flashlight & batteries
Cash in small bills
Extra clothing & blanket
Pet food

3. Prepare Your Vehicle♥️

Keep the gas tank at least half full.
Store your “Go Bag” in the vehicle if fires are nearby.
Have a paper map in case GPS fails.

4. Stay Informed♥️
Monitor Nova Scotia government alerts.
Follow local fire departments on social media.
Listen to local radio for updates.

5. Help Your Community♥️

Check on elderly neighbours.
Offer help to families with young children or pets.

Stay safe. Stay ready. 💛🔥
